What Is A De Tan CreamÂ
De tan creams are specifically crafted to reduce hyperpigmentation or dark spots caused by sun damage. Long time sun exposure to the sun triggers your delicate skin barriers which results in excessive production of melanin, turning your skin complexion darker. A de-tan cream targets the hyperpigmented areas through deep exfoliation, leading to rejuvenation of skin cells and your natural complexion.Â
How To Use A Tan Removal Cream  Â
There are many de tan soaps and tan removal creams available in the market. Still, only through the proper application can you attain a natural radiant glow. Let's understand how to use de tan cream for the best results:Â
-
CleansingÂ
Any effective skincare ritual starts with proper cleansing, and we’ll follow the same here. Use a gentle cleanser to remove the oil and dirt from your skin, so that the de-tan cream penetrates well into the skin.Â
-
Patch Testing
Before applying any product including a de-tan cream on your skin, always consider conducting a patch test to avoid side effects like developing rashes, redness, or skin irritation. In this case, apply a little amount of Pokonut de-tan soap on your elbow or right behind your ear and leave it for 10-15 minutes. Unless you feel any adverse reaction, go ahead with the next step.Â
-
ApplicationÂ
If you are using a skin tan removal soap, make a lather with it and apply it evenly on your face and other tanned areas. By creating a lather, you can ensure the even distribution of the product throughout your skin.Â
For those using a de tan cream, take a generous amount of cream and apply it on affected areas with your fingertip in the form of a dot. Then, gently rub it all over the pigmented skin for a more even application.Â
-
DurationÂ
The best way is to follow the instructions given on the product that you are using. However, generally leaving the de-tan cream or soap on for at least 15 minutes is recommended.
-
RinsingÂ
Once the job is done with the de-tan cream, it's now time to rinse it off. We'd suggest you use lukewarm water to wash it off, followed by pat drying gently with a soft cotton cloth. Don't go rough on your skin during the washing phase, as it may potentially trigger your skin barriers.Â

Common Mistakes To Avoid
-
Rushing the tan removal process will not help you in getting rid of the tan any quicker.Â
-
Massaging roughly is not a good idea.Â
-
Over-exfoliation can strip off natural oil from your skin, so you should consider avoiding it.Â
-
If you are using a de-tan mask or cream, don't use it more than twice a week.Â
-
It might take some time to remove years-old tan. Be patient and consistent.Â
